When you search for the Illuminati, you'll find a mix of historical information and numerous conspiracy theories. The term often refers to a secret society believed to manipulate global events, but much of the information is speculative and sensationalized. Websites, forums, and videos may present various interpretations, blending facts with fiction, which can lead to confusion about the true nature of the Illuminati. Overall, the search results reflect a cultural fascination with secrecy and power dynamics.

Is the Illuminati made up of Freemasons?

No. The Illuminati no longer exists, not since 1785. While many Illuminati were also in the Freemasons, the two were separate orders.
